What is LG Dishwasher CL Error Code?
The LG dishwasher CL error code is a common issue that many LG dishwasher owners may encounter. When the CL error code appears on the dishwasher's display, it means that the child lock feature has been activated. The child lock feature is designed to prevent children from accidentally starting or stopping the dishwasher or changing its settings.
When the child lock is activated, the dishwasher's control panel becomes locked, and you will not be able to operate the dishwasher until the child lock is deactivated. How to fix LG Dishwasher CL Error Code?
Here are the steps you can take to fix the CL error code on your LG dishwasher,
Turn off the dishwasher
The first thing you should do is turn off the dishwasher by unplugging it or turning off the circuit breaker that supplies power to it. This will help reset the control panel and clear any error codes that may be causing the problem.
Press and hold the Rinse button
Next, press and hold the Rinse button on the control panel for at least three seconds. This should unlock the control panel and allow you to start using the dishwasher again.
Test the dishwasher
Once you've unlocked the control panel, you can test the dishwasher to see if the problem has been resolved. To do this, simply select a wash cycle and start the dishwasher. If it starts running without any issues, then the CL error code has been fixed. If the CL error code persists even after following the above steps, it's best to consult the LG customer support for further assistance.

LG dishwashers offer a variety of features designed to make washing dishes easier and more efficient. One standout feature of LG dishwashers is their "TrueSteam" technology. This feature uses high-temperature steam to help remove stubborn food residue and grease from dishes, resulting in a more thorough cleaning. The steam also helps to sanitize the dishes, making them more hygienic.
LG dishwashers also feature a variety of wash cycle options, including a gentle cycle for delicate dishes and a high-temperature cycle for heavily soiled items. Some models even offer a "Turbo" cycle, which is designed to clean dishes quickly and efficiently. Many models feature adjustable racks and tines, allowing you to customize the interior to fit a variety of dish sizes and shapes.
They also have a delay start option, which allows you to set the dishwasher to start at a later time, making it easier to fit dishwashing into your busy schedule. Finally, LG dishwashers are known for their quiet operation. With noise levels as low as 40 decibels, they are some of the quietest dishwashers on the market, making them ideal for open-concept kitchens or homes with sleeping babies.
